Shopping

In Chudleigh, you can shop at local stores for unique gifts and souvenirs. The nearest mall is Princesshay, about 14.5km away, offering a vibrant shopping experience. If you're up for a drive, check out Pixieland, 20.9km away, or the South Molton Panier Market, 48.3km away.

Recreation

Explore Haldon Forest Park, a serene escape with lush woodlands perfect for leisurely walks and mindfulness. Stover Country Park offers tranquil lakes and scenic trails, ideal for relaxation. For a bit of fun, Shaldon Cliffs Pitch and Putt provides a casual golfing experience amidst beautiful outdoor scenery.

Adventure

Experience the thrill at Go Ape Haldon, a zipline ropes course 4.8km from Chudleigh, perfect for adrenaline junkies. Explore the stunning scenery along the S W Coast Path, an 12.9km hiking trail offering breathtaking views. For water enthusiasts, SeaSports South West, located 9.7km away, provides exhilarating water sports adventures.

Nightlife

For a lively night out, catch a show at the Pavilions Teignmouth or the Shaftesbury Theatre, both just 9.7km from Chudleigh, offering a mix of entertainment and culture. If you fancy a bit more travel, the Barnfield Theatre, located 14.5km away, also has a vibrant atmosphere.

Best time to go to Chudleigh

The best time to visit Chudleigh is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January42.4°F (5.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February42.8°F (6.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March44.6°F (7.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April47.8°F (8.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May52.9°F (11.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June58.3°F (14.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
July61.5°F (16.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
August61.2°F (16.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
September58.1°F (14.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
October54.0°F (12.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November48.2°F (9.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
December45.0°F (7.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

What's the seasonal weather in Chudleigh?

The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 7°C. Average annual precipitation for Chudleigh is 843 mm.
